About 15 Braden Close
15 Braden Close is a three-bedroom semi-detached house in Aylesbury (HP21 7JU). It has a recorded floor area of 93 m² (around 1001 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1967-1975 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(January 2015) shows an E (score 54),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. The recommended improvements would lift it to C (score 80), a 2-band jump. The latest certificate is from January 2015,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
One planning record on file: an extension approved in 2012. Past consents include an extension and a porch,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. It lags the bulk of the postcode on energy efficiency (less efficient than 80% of similar EPCs). Last sold in June 2015, so it's been off the market for around 11 years. Across 1998–2015, sale prices on this property compounded at 5.9%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£404,000 is 44.3% above the 2015 sale price.
